substitutions:
# Default name
name: "athom-rgbcw-bulb"
# Default friendly name
friendly_name: "Athom RGBCW Bulb"
# Allows ESP device to be automatically linked to an 'Area' in Home Assistant. Typically used for areas such as 'Lounge Room', 'Kitchen' etc
room: ""
# Description as appears in ESPHome & top of webserver page
device_description: "athom esp32c3 rgbcw bulb"
# Project Name
project_name: "China Athom Technology.Athom RGBCW Bulb"
# Projection version denotes the release version of the yaml file, allowing checking of deployed vs latest version
project_version: "v3.2.3"
# Restore the light (GPO switch) upon reboot to state:
light_restore_mode: RESTORE_DEFAULT_ON
# Define a domain for this device to use. i.e. iot.home.lan (so device will appear as athom-smart-plug-v2.iot.home.lan in DNS/DHCP logs)
dns_domain: ".local"
# Set timezone of the smart plug. Useful if the plug is in a location different to the HA server. Can be entered in unix Country/Area format (i.e. "Australia/Sydney")
timezone: ""
# Set the duration between the sntp service polling ntp.org servers for an update
sntp_update_interval: 6h
# Network time servers for your region, enter from lowest to highest priority. To use local servers update as per zones or countries at: https://www.ntppool.org/zone/@
sntp_server_1: "0.pool.ntp.org"
sntp_server_2: "1.pool.ntp.org"
sntp_server_3: "2.pool.ntp.org"
# Enables faster network connections, with last connected SSID being connected to and no full scan for SSID being undertaken
wifi_fast_connect: "false"
# Define logging level: NONE, ERROR, WARN, INFO, DEBUG (Default), VERBOSE, VERY_VERBOSE
log_level: "DEBUG"
# Enable or disable the use of IPv6 networking on the device
ipv6_enable: "false"
color_interlock: "true"
